Ryman Premier Division new-boys Witham Town have been left in shock after their chairman Tony Last passed away suddenly last night.

The club announced on their website this morning that their long-serving chairman had suffered a heart attack while at the Village Glass Stadium on Thursday evening.

Despite all efforts to revive Tony, the paramedics were unable to save him.

A statement on the club website said: “It is a very sad time for Tony’s family as well as the club and we are sure you will all want to join us in sending our deepest condolences to his wife Linda and their family.

“Gone but never forgotten.”
